What is the pH of the solution formed when 25 mL of 0.173 M NaOH is added to 35 mL of 0.342 M HCl?
Ugo [173]

Answer:

0.89

Explanation:

You are mixing an acid and a base, so there will be a neutralization reaction.

One of the reactants will be in excess, so we must determine its concentration and then calculate the pH.

<em>Moles of NaOH </em>

Moles of NaOH = 25 × 0.173

Moles of NaOH = 4.32 mmol

===============

<em>Moles of HCl </em>

Moles of HCl = 35 × 0.342

Moles of HCl = 12.0 mmol

===============

<em>Amount of excess reactant </em>

              NaOH + HCl ⟶ NaCl +H₂O

<em>n</em>/mmol:   4.32      12.0

The 4.32 mmol of NaOH reacts completely with 4.32 mmol of HCl.

Excess HCl = 12.0 – 4.32

Excess HCl = 7.6 mmol

===============

<em>Concentration of the excess HCl </em>

Total volume = 25 + 35

Total volume = 60 mL

<em>c </em>= millimoles HCl/millilitres HCl

<em>c</em> = 7.6/60

<em>c</em> = 0.13 mol/L

===============

<em>Calculate the pH </em>

The HCl dissociates completely to hydronium ions, so

[H₃O⁺] = 0.13 mol·L⁻¹

pH = -log[H₃O⁺]

pH = -log0.13

pH = 0.89

The density of gold is 19.3 g/cm3. What is the volume of a 575 gram bar of pure gold?
Gnoma [55]

Answer:

The  answer to your question is: Volume = 29.79 cm³

Explanation:

Data

Density of gold = 19.3 g/cm3

Mass = 575 grams

Formula

density = mass / volume

Volume = mass/density

Volume = 575 g / 19.3 g/cm3

Volume = 29.79 cm³
